An informal history of sensational, scientific, silly and startling attractions based on 17th, 18th and 19th Century Broadsides from the collection of Ricky Jay. With some observations on the convention of promoting such appearances, and digressions on the manner and method of printing advertisements to do so, and with insight into the psychology employed to that end. Includes such attractions as Bertolotto's Industrious Fleas, the Pig Faced Lady, Capelli's Learned Cats and the Singing Mouse . [more...]
